For the newcomers would be handy to update README and into a upper part of it describe what this script is actually doing.
It is possibly mentioned in README:
seedcross will start to:
load the torrents from the download client.
parse the name to get the title,year,episode etc, with these keyword ask Jackett server to search torrents in your pre-configured trackers.
check if there's match by title and size.
add the download link to the download client, in paused state, you will need to 'force recheck' in qBittorrent to scan the files and start seeding.
and Yes, if the configuration haven't been set, it will redirect to the Settings page.
but it is too deep in README, impractically mentioned way below the installation steps. But you usually decide whether to install something after you know what it exactly do for you.
Btw. Docker is not a requirement as you claim in README, because "Install with source" does not require it IMO.
